Tulip Tulipa fosteriana Concerto
  • £3.99

A fosteriana tulip that grows to around 30cm tall, 'Concerto' bears large, fragrant, buttercream flowers with yellow bases and black centres. Set amid attractive grey-green foliage, their exquisite colouring will mix beautifully with bolder colours. A mid-height, long-lasting tulip with sturdy stems, it is perfect for beds, borders and containers, and make an excellent cut flower. Easy to grow and fully hardy, 'Concerto' will flower from April to May, adding a fresh and vibrant feel to your spring garden, patio or decking. Otherwise known as Emperor tulips, fosteriana varieties are closely related to their wild ancestors so will naturalise easily if left in the ground. Supplied as a pack of 15 bulbs for autumn planting, they are best placed in a sunny or lightly shaded position, in rich, well-drained soil.

Tulip Tulipa gregii Toronto
  • £3.99

Deep salmon-pink flowers with golden centres, rising above mounds of grey-green, mottled foliage, make 'Toronto' a lively addition to your garden in spring. An impressive multiheaded tulip, each bulb giving 3-5 long-lasting blooms, they flower from late April through May and will not fail to bring warmth to your planting schemes. One of the most popular varieties, this characterful greigii tulip boasts a well-deserved RHS Award of Garden Merit. Versatile and easy to grow, the large-petalled blooms on short, sturdy stems look stunning in rock gardens, beds, borders and containers. They also make an attractive display in a vase. This fully hardy perennial tulip is easy to grow and will naturalise well if left in the ground. Mix with contrasting colours for dramatic effect. Supplied as a pack of 15 bulbs ready for planting, they are best planted in groups in borders or pots. Place in a sunny or lightly shaded position in rich, well-drained soil.
